*   >> Læs Uddannelse artikler >> science >> programming

Arrays i C ++ med Chrys

Du begynder med den type; et rum; derefter vifte navn; de firkantede parenteser. Inde i firkantede parenteser har du et helt tal, som er størrelsen af ​​array. For at definere en række int, der vil have en størrelse (maksimalt antal elementer) på 15, skal du skrive noget lignende: int myArr [15]; IndexElements i et array har positioner. Overvej følgende matrix: int mærker [] = {43, 29, 35, 50, 60, 65, 78, 56, 67, 90}; Det første element i array er 43; den anden er 29; den tredje er 35, og så videre. Værdierne i et array har positioner. Disse positioner kaldes indeks.

Index (position) optælling i computing og arrays begynde fra nul, ikke én. Så indekset for 43 ovenfor er nul; at af 29 er 1; at 35 er 2; og så on.Accessing en Array ElementTo adgang til en værdi i et array, du behøver at vide indekset for værdien. Syntaksen for at få adgang en array element (værdi) efter at der er defineret eller initialiseres array er: arrayName [index] Hvis du ønsker at få adgang til første element i ovenstående array, skal du skrive: mærker [0] at få adgang til andet element du ville skrive: mærker [1] For at få adgang til tredje element, du ville skrive mærker [2] og så videre.

Altid trække 1 fra den engelske stand til at få adgang index.When et array værdi, bør indekset ikke være mere end array-størrelse minus 1. Tildeling og ændring Array ValueAfter definerer et array, er størrelsen af ​​array kendes. Også efter initialisering et array, er størrelsen af ​​array kendes. Efter at have defineret et array, den er tom. Men efter initialisering af et array, array ikke er tom. Uanset hvad er tilfældet, kan du tildele en værdi eller ændre værdien af ​​et element i et array som følger: arrayName = værdi Antag, at du vil have en værdi på 47 for en int-array ved indeks, 5.

Hvis du vil tildele eller ændre værdien på indeks, 5, ville du skrive: mærker [5] = 47; Glem ikke semikolon i slutningen af ​​erklæringen (ovenfor). Husk, indeks 5 betyder engelsk position 6. ExampleIn følgende eksempel, er en int-array defineret. Fem heltal er tildelt til denne array og derefter vises. Displayet gøres ved hjælp af en for-løkke. # include hjælp namespace std; int main () {int Myint [5]; Myint [0] = 8; Myint [1] = 63; Myint [2] = 55; Myint [3] = 78; Myint [4] = 2; for (int i = 0; i {cout} tilbagevenden 0;.

} Vi er kommet til slutningen af ​​denne del af serien, før vi forlader denne del, ved, at under initialisering et array, kan du stadig har størrelsen af ​​array i de firkantede parenteser som i

Page   <<  [1] [2] [3] >>
Copyright © 2008 - 2016 Læs Uddannelse artikler,https://uddannelse.nmjjxx.com All rights reserved.